  • It is not possible to exchange parametric information of CAD (Computer Aided Design) models based on the current version of STEP (Standard leer the Exchange of Product model data). The design intent can be lost during the STEP transfer of CAD models. The ISO Parametrics Group has proposed the SMCH (Solid Model Construction History) schema in June 2000 that includes structures fur exchange of parametric information. This paper proposes the macro parametric approach that is intended to provide capabilities to transfer parametric information. In this approach, CAD models are exchanged in the form of macro files. The macro file contains user commands which are used in the modeling phase. To exchange CAD models using the macro parametric approach, modeling commands of commercial CAD systems are analyzed. Those commands are classified by the grouping method suggested by Bill Anderson. As a neutral file format, a standard modeling commands set has been defined. Mapping relations between the standard modeling commands set and the native modeling commands set of commercial CAD systems are defined.

  • This paper presents design automation system using API and parametric modeling of solid modeler, which is applied on axial fans for cooling towers. The design data including chord length and twist angle according to the fan length are given by design program, and API functions are applied to automate the modeling and assembly process of fan blade. The boss to connect fan and motor is designed with parametric design function provided by UG so as to be flexibly changed by the value of design parameters. The process of generating 2-D drafting for parts and an assembly is also automated. With developed system, the modeling time is reduced to 5 minutes even with unskilled operators.

  • This paper describes a three dimensional parametric modeling system for transmission gears of tractor. In conventional design and manufacturing, information about three dimensional shapes has been described in engineering drawings. However drawing based design presents several problems; 1) communication errors between the designer and the modeller or manufacturer. 2) time taken and costs incurred in the design process. To solve these problems the system of parametric design based modeling has been proposed. Developed system in this paper consists of four steps; 1) parametric design of transmission gears with a solid modeler. 2) evaluation of gear geometry and strength. 3) dynamic simulation for gear interference check. 4) gear stress analysis with a CAE software. The proposed system has been tested in the fields and found to be a useful system.

  • FEM 수치해석을 위한 사면체격자 생성을 위해서는 물체의 볼륨정보를 표현할 수 있는 Boundary Representation (B-Rep) 모델이 필요하다. 공학분야에서는 파라메트릭 솔리드 모델링(Parametric Solid Modeling) 방법을 사용하여 B-Rep 모델을 정의한다. 반면 지질모델링은 메쉬 기반의 불연속(discrete) 모델링 방법을 사용하는데 이를 지질솔리드모델(Sealed Geological Model)이라 부르며 지층, 단층, 관입암, 모델 경계면과 같은 지질학적 인터페이스들을 이용해 지질도메인을 정의한다. 공학분야의 파라메트릭 모델링과 불연속 모델링 방식의 자료구조의 차이로 인해 불연속 B-Rep 모델은 공학분야에서 사용하는 다양한 오픈소스, 상용 메쉬제작 소프트웨어와 쉽게 호환되지 않는다. 이 논문에서는 공학용 메쉬 제작 소프트웨어와의 호환성을 가지도록 지질솔리드모델을 대표적인 오픈소스인 Gmsh와 상용 FEM 해석 소프트웨어인 COMSOL로 변환하는 프로그램을 제작하였다. 지질모델링 소프트웨어를 통해 제작한 복잡한 지질구조모델을 사용자 편의성을 갖춘 다수의 상용 소프트웨어서 쉽게 활용할 수 있어 지열, 암석역학 등 다양한 지구과학 시뮬레이션 연구에 도움이 될 것으로 생각된다.

  • Study on flexural retrofitting of RC beams using external bars with additional intermediate anchorages at soffit is reported in this paper. Effects of varying number of anchorages in the external bars at soffit were studied by finite element analysis using ANSYS 12.0 software. The results were also compared with available experimental results for beam with only two end anchorages. Two sets of reference and retrofitted beam specimens with two, three, four and five anchorages were analysed and the results are reported. FE modeling and non-linear analysis was carried out by discrete reinforcement modeling using Solid65, Solid45 and Link8 elements. Combin39 spring elements were used for modeling the frictional contact between the soffit and the external bars. The beam specimens were subjected to four-point bending and incremental loading was applied till failure. The entire process of modeling, application of incremental loading and generation of output in text and graphical format were carried out using ANSYS Parametric Design Language.

  • Developed in this research is a surface modeling kernel for various CAD/CAM applications. Its internal surface representations are rational parametric polynomials, which are generalizations of nonrational Bezier, Ferguson, Coons and NURBS surface, and are very fast in evaluation. The kernel is designed under the OOP concepts and coded in C++ on PCs. The present implementation of the kernel supports surface construction methods, such as point data interpolation, skinning, sweeping and blending. It also has NURBS conversion routines and offers the IGES and ZES format for geometric information exchange. It includes some geometric processing routines, such as surface/surface intersection, curve/surface intersection, curve projection and so forth. We are continuing to work with the kernel and eventually develop a B-Rep based solid modeler.
